🛒 Ingredients You’ll Need
- 1 box lemon cake mix (15.25 oz)
- 2 cans lemon pie filling (21 oz each)
- 8 oz cream cheese (softened to room temperature)
- ½ cup gran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- ½ cup unsalted butter (1 stick, cold and sliced into thin pats)
- Optional garnish: powdered sugar, lemon zest, or whipped cream
👩🍳 Step-by-Step Method
Step 1: Preheat and Prepare
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Lightly gr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with butter or non-stick spray. This ensures the cake won’t stick and makes serving much easier.
Step 2: Spread the Lemon Pie Filling
Pour the lemon pie filling directly into the bottom of your greased baking dish. Use a spatula to spread it out evenly so every bite of the cake has that bright citrusy base.
